Do you want a warbird, private aviation, what era?.., etc...?
TopFlite makes a great series of kits in the warbird category that I've always admired. There's a P-51, a Corsair, a P-40, P-47, all in the .60 size range. I've not built any of these, but if I were looking for a scale project, I'd give each one, really all of them a good look. All fall around a 65" wingspan. A club friend built 3 of the above planes, by the book, and I was always impressed to see all 3 together on flying day. I do believe if these planes are built by the book, you're near guaranteed a great flying plane... Top Flite.. can't go wrong is my 2 cents. |

Yeah for warbirds you can't beat Topfligt... even their Cessna 182 and discontinued Beach Bonanza and Cessna 310 kits are supposedly real good. If not a warbird I'd go for a Carl Goldberg or Sig Piper Cub... Cubs are a perfect first scale subject... you can also build them as Clipped wing variant to shorten the span.

I like the Sig Craftsmen Series for scale kits. They have excellent instructions, easy to read plans, and the models fly very well.
The kits do not possess jig lock construction. Some parts need to be cut out by the builder, too. Overall, they aren't that hard to build,though. I would suggest the Sig Spacewalker II, for a first scale build. |
